While exploring the ruins of a lost civilization buried beneath the desert sands, you uncover a chamber untouched by time — and within it, a golden throne occupied by this jeweled queen. When you disturb the dust at her feet, her eyes open, glowing faintly with light reflected from the gems that cover her armor. She rises, not from death, but from slumber. She stands like a living statue of divine craftsmanship — a regal woman draped in gold so intricate it seems alive. Every curve of her armor is etched with curling patterns, set with jewels that burn like stars: sapphire, ruby, and emerald glinting against the glow of her bronze-toned metal. Her crown, a lattice of ancient artistry, radiates authority and something older — as if it once commanded not just men, but elements. Her skin is pale beneath the weight of her adornments, her dark hair falling in silken rivers down her shoulders. There’s an intensity to her gaze — calm, but utterly commanding — the kind of look that makes you feel as though she sees far more than your face. Behind her, the carved archway hints at a kingdom built by gods or forgotten empires, where she reigns by right of power. She calls herself Queen Aurelia of the First Dawn, Guardian of the Eternal Vault
